Minimums are flexible, and 100 units is the run we usually recommend starting at. It is enough to launch a product without committing to stock you have not sold yet. Per-unit pricing drops as the quantity climbs, so if you know a reorder is coming it is worth quoting two volumes at once.
Ten to fifteen business days from the day you approve your proof. The clock starts at approval, not at your order, so the time you spend reviewing the proof is yours and does not eat into the window. We will tell you upfront if a deadline is not going to work.
No. Every order ships free to any address in all fifty states, with no minimum order value and no surcharge for distance. Delivery is included in the ten to fifteen business day window, not added on top of it.
Yes. A digital dieline and print proof come back with every order, free, and nothing reaches the press until you sign it off. If something is wrong we revise and send it again. Physical samples are also available on request, priced by how complex the build is.

Four stocks. White cardstock prints the sharpest and is what most brands choose. Brown recyclable kraft is uncoated and natural. Corrugated adds wall strength for boxes that ship on their own. Luxury rigid board is the premium option for gift sets and flagship products. Every one of them takes the full finishing menu.
Printing is full-color CMYK offset, with Pantone matching when a brand color has to land exactly the same on every reorder. We also print box interiors and lay white ink on dark stock. Finishes are foil stamping, spot UV, embossing, debossing, matte or gloss lamination, and window die-cuts, in any combination.
Adobe Illustrator, PDF, EPS, or PSD. Set them up at 300 DPI or higher in CMYK, with fonts outlined, and we can work straight from them. If your files are not press-ready we will tell you what needs fixing rather than printing something that disappoints you.

Your product dimensions and a quantity. Size is one of the main things a price is built from, so measure the bottle, jar, or tube in inches and give us length, width, and depth. Without those a quote is guesswork that will change on you later. Everything else, material, finishes, artwork, we can recommend or help with.
We draw your dieline and send a digital proof. You review it, we revise anything that needs revising, and once you approve, the job goes to press. From that approval it is ten to fifteen business days to a free delivery anywhere in the US.
Yes. Your artwork and specs stay on file, so a repeat run skips the back and forth and goes almost straight to quote. Reorders are also where Pantone matching earns its keep, since it holds the color to the same reference as the first batch instead of drifting a shade.
